Gross motor play is so much more than just “getting energy out.”
When children climb, jump, balance, run, push, pull, and move their bodies together, they’re building:
• Coordination and body awareness
• Strength, balance, and confidence
• Problem-solving skills
• Emotional regulation
• Communication and social skills
Team-based gross motor activities also teach children how to collaborate, take turns, encourage one another, and work toward a shared goal, all through play!!
These moments may look simple, but they’re laying the foundation for lifelong physical, social, and emotional development. The best learning often happens when little bodies are in motion.
